    In olden days, a wedding in a Sindhi home would mean a buzzing neighbourhood. The male clan would deal with the logistics of a wedding, distributing wedding cards, booking tickets for relatives traveling from far and wide, making arrangements for their stay, booking Maharaj or cook/s to cater to family/relatives, friends etc. The female clan (from the family as well as from the neighborhood) on the other hand would  take charge of stocking spices, grains, pulses etc. Almost a fortnight before marriage eve, ladies in the family and around would wind up the daily chores and come together to make…
